我有一个关于用CakePHP 3通过SSL连接到mySQL的问题,我知道这可能更多的是一个PHP问题,但我只是在这里编写了我使用的框架。
因此,我设置了一个远程mysql服务器,并希望将CakePHP与它连接起来。不幸的是,我得到了MySQL错误:
SQLSTATE[HY000] [3159] Connections using insecure transport are prohibited while --require_secure_transport=ON.
因为我配置服务器只允许安全连接。之后,我搜索了有关安全连接的Cakephp文档,并找到了ssl证书。这是我的装置:
conf
我能够运行“迁移”很好。如果我使用请求::all (),我能够获得所有的表单输入,但是当我试图将数据添加到mysql数据库表时,我会得到以下错误:
ErrorException in ClassLoader.php line 412:
include(Correct_Path/full-personal/database/migrations/2015_07_06_035501_resume_requesters.php): failed to open stream: No such file or directory
我目前有一个带有以下代码的控制器方法的表单:
$input = Req
我试图对数据库进行插入,但得到了以下错误:
列计数与第1行的值计数不匹配。
<?php
//abm.php
public function __construct($nombre_tabla){
$this->conexion = new mysqli("localhost","root","","prueba");
$this->nombre_tabla = $nombre_tabla;
}
public function setCampos($cam
我在跟踪这个
版本细节;
Apache 2.4.16 php 5.6.11 mysql社区安装程序5.6.25
目录结构:
C:服务器每个安装程序都在这里
Windows系统-7-64位。
误差
httpd.exe: Syntax error on line 178 of C:/server/httpd/Apache24
/conf/httpd.conf: Cannot load C:\\server\\php\\php5apache2_4.dll into
server: The specified module could not be found.
导致的代码
LoadModule p
我有一个数据库,其中有一个表和一些列。其中一列是标志(类似于SO),用户可以在其中标记注释。我想给每个用户每天5个旗帜。因此,如果用户在24小时内使用了2个标志,则在24小时结束时,这些标志应重置为5。我真的不知道该怎么做。有没有特别的mysql函数?
PHP:
$query=mysql_query("UPDATE users SET flags='5' WHERE userID='$user'");
我如何让它每24小时重复一次?(如果这是正确的解决方案)
我正在使用php mysql后端开发extjs4.2应用程序。我可以通过表单添加存储记录。而不是使用代理来存储autosyncs,向mysql添加新记录。然而,它并不创建一个"put“请求,而是创建一个'post‘请求。我已经看到了关于相同问题的其他示例,其中大多数都指向配置模型的idProperty。
我的前端使用表单创建新的/POST或编辑现有/PUT,这取决于是否存在唯一的模型ID
商店使用ajax代理
Save controller:
var form = this.getAnnDetailsPanel1().getForm();
var formDat
我使用下面的代码从表employee中返回最后一个插入id,请告诉我下面的代码有什么问题:
<?php
$temp_array = mysql_query("select last_insert_id() from employee");
//now you can display it, to test it
echo $temp_array;
?>
它返回0值。请告诉我不使用max()的简单方法,
如何保存以下表单?
<form name="myform">
<input type="text" name="title" value="title" />
$result = mysql_query("SELECT id, text from details where parent='$parent'
order by id asc") or die('Error');
while(list($id,$ftext) = mysql_fetch_row
我不得不移动一个现有的网站到另一个主机(使用相同的软件)。现在,当第二个用户试图对实体执行某些操作(通过编程添加、编辑或删除)时,站点会失败,但会出现以下错误:
Fatal error: Class 'Entity\User' not found in /home/.../www/includes/Objects/Proxies/__CG__EntityUser.php on line 9
下面是配置:
ini_set('include_path', ROOT_PATH.'/includes');
require_once(ROOT_PATH.&